Portable systems are the least pricey, however as a trade-off, you have to link a tube to the outdoors and these systems are normally noisier than more costly, built-in systems.
Multi-split systems, ducted systems, and ceiling-mounted cassettes are the most costly due to the fact that they need more labour time to install, so if you have a smaller budget, it's beneficial thinking about the less expensive alternatives. This is particularly true for built-in systems as there will be considerably more work involved with threading pipes and wires, in addition to making great when the work is done, than those simply plugging in a portable system.
If you end up purchasing something that isn't as strong as your size needs, you will wind up investing more cash in the long run as you'll need to supplement the machine with extra units. Cooling power is determined in British Thermal Systems (BTUs). BTUs are the quantity of energy the system utilizes to cool and heat.
Nevertheless, it's much better to buy a slightly more powerful system than you require since an a/c unit that's constantly performing at optimal capability uses more energy. When in doubt, speak with an air conditioning installer who can recommend on the right system and system for your area. This can be specifically beneficial during the wet, wet British winter seasons. Fan speeds impact how rapidly the room will cool down. If you select the highest fan setting, the indoor unit will be noisier than if you leave it on the most affordable setting, but the space will cool off quicker.
High-end air conditioning units are almost silent, but most systems make a minimum of some sound. Before buying any air conditioning system, be sure to check the decibel rating of the indoor and outside systems, specifically if you plan to install it in a bedroom.
